Naomi Campbell Sings, Dances, and Shines in Pucci’s Fall 2025 Campaign

For Fall 2025, Pucci turns up the volume on glamour with Naomi Campbell as the radiant star of its latest campaign. Dancing to disco rhythms under flashing club lights, the British supermodel sings the phrase “Did someone say Pucci?” in a performance reminiscent of Studio 54 at its peak.

The imagery, captured by Oliver Hadlee Pearch, blends photography and film, showcasing Campbell in shimmering pieces from the Passepartout collection—including metallic lurex jersey dresses and labyrinth-print sweaters that reinterpret animal motifs with a bold twist. In one frame, she raises her arms joyfully, her hair flying as strobe lights amplify the electric atmosphere.

Artistic director Camille Miceli, who has a long personal and professional history with Campbell, emphasized that the supermodel perfectly embodies the collection’s spirit: “She exudes diva glamour and a radiant energy that feels both magnetic and joyful.” For Miceli, who once trained under Azzedine Alaïa before working with Marc Jacobs at Louis Vuitton, Campbell is more than a muse—she’s a loyal friend and an eternal connector, affectionately nicknamed NC Connect.

Courtesy of Pucci

Timed with the collection’s arrival in stores, the campaign will be followed by an immersive Pucci experience during Milan Fashion Week, designed to make visitors feel as if they are dancing alongside Naomi herself. In Miceli’s words, glamour serves as “a much-needed antidote in uncertain times,” underscoring Pucci’s belief in fashion as a source of escapism and fantasy.
